CDK
Cyclin dependent kinase
CDKs (Cyclin-dependent kinases) are serine-threonine kinases first discovered for their role in regulating the cell cycle. They are also involved in regulating transcription, mRNA processing, and the differentiation of nerve cells. CDKs are relatively small proteins, with molecular weights ranging from 34 to 40 kDa, and contain little more than the kinase domain. In fact, yeast cells can proliferate normally when their CDK gene has been replaced with the homologous human gene. By definition, a CDK binds a regulatory protein called a cyclin. Without cyclin, CDK has little kinase activity; only the cyclin-CDK complex is an active kinase.
There are around 20 Cyclin-dependent kinases (CDK1-20) known till date. CDK1, 4 and 5 are involved in cell cycle, and CDK 7, 8, 9 and 11 are associated with transcription.
CDK levels remain relatively constant throughout the cell cycle and most regulation is post-translational. Most knowledge of CDK structure and function is based on CDKs of S. pombe (Cdc2), S. cerevisia (CDC28), and vertebrates (CDC2 and CDK2). The four major mechanisms of CDK regulation are cyclin binding, CAK phosphorylation, regulatory inhibitory phosphorylation, and binding of CDK inhibitory subunits (CKIs).

PHA-793887
0 ImagesPHA-793887 is a CDK inhibitor (with IC50 values of 8 nM for Cdk2, 60 nM for Cdk1, 62 nM for Cdk4, 138 nM for Cdk9). PHA-793887 inhibits purified GSK3β (IC50 79 nM). PHA-793887 reduces the phosphorylation level of nucleophosmin/cdc6, induces G1/G2/M phase arrest, and triggers Apoptosis by activating Caspase-3. PHA-793887 exhibits anticancer activity against leukemia. PHA-793887 can be used in research related to acute leukemia, chronic myeloid leukemia, and advanced/metastatic solid tumors. -

CGP60474
0 ImagesCGP60474, a highly potent anti-endotoxemic agent, is a potent cyclin-dependent kinase (CDK) inhibitor (IC50 values are 26, 3, 4, 216, 10, 200 and 13 nM for CDK1/B, CDK2/E, CDK2/A, CDK4/D, CDK5/p25, CDK7/H and CDK9/T, respectively). CGP60474 is a selective and ATP-competitive PKC inhibitor. -
